AI interview intelligence for recruiting teams
Metaview automatically generates structured interview notes and summaries by listening to your calls via Zoom, Teams, or Google Meet — with no bot joining. It captures candidate responses, scores answers against your criteria, and surfaces key quotes for hiring decisions. Integrates with Greenhouse, Lever, and Workday ATS.

Enterprise HR management with AI
Workday embeds AI across HCM, payroll, finance, and planning with capabilities like skills matching, attrition prediction, pay equity analysis, and generative AI for HR workflows. Workday AI is used by 60% of the Fortune 500 for core HR operations and strategic workforce planning.
AI-powered video interviewing and assessment
HireVue uses AI to analyze video interviews and assess candidates on job-relevant competencies through structured behavioral science. Game-based assessments evaluate cognitive and emotional traits. Used by Unilever, Goldman Sachs, and Delta to screen thousands of candidates efficiently.
AI recruiting assistant automating 1M+ interviews monthly for top employers
Paradox's AI recruiting assistant Olivia handles the entire candidate experience conversationally — engaging applicants via SMS or web chat, screening them against job requirements, scheduling interviews directly on hiring managers' calendars, sending reminders, and answering FAQs through onboarding. Unlike traditional ATS platforms, Olivia provides sub-minute response times 24/7, dramatically improving candidate completion rates. Trusted by McDonald's, Unilever, FedEx, and CVS Health for high-volume hourly and corporate hiring — processing over 1 million candidate interviews monthly. Paradox's conversational approach reduces time-to-hire by up to 80% for enterprise clients.
AI writing tool for inclusive job descriptions
Textio analyzes job descriptions and performance feedback for biased language that deters underrepresented candidates. Its augmented writing platform provides real-time suggestions to improve inclusivity and predict the quality and diversity of the candidate pool before posting.
